About this opportunity:

Join Ericsson as a Data Scientist. This position plays a crucial role in the development of Python-based solutions, their deployment within a Kubernetes-based environment, and ensuring the smooth data flow for our machine learning and data science initiatives. The ideal candidate will possess a strong foundation in Python programming, hands-on experience with ElasticSearch, Logstash, and Kibana (ELK), a solid grasp of fundamental Spark concepts, and familiarity with visualization tools such as Grafana and Kibana. Furthermore, a background in ML Ops and expertise in both machine learning model development and deployment will be highly advantageous.  

What you will do:

  • Python Development: Write clean, efficient and maintainable Python code to support data engineering tasks including collection, transformation and integration with ML models.
  • Data Pipeline Development: Design, build and maintain robust data pipelines to gather, process and transform data from multiple sources into formats suitable for ML and analytics, leveraging ELK, Python and other leading technologies.
  • Spark Knowledge: Apply core Spark concepts for distributed data processing where required, and optimize workflows for performance and scalability.
  • ELK Integration: Implement ElasticSearch, Logstash and Kibana for data ingestion, indexing, search and real-time visualization. Knowledge of OpenSearch and related tooling is beneficial.
  • Dashboards and Visualization: Create and manage Grafana and Kibana dashboards to deliver real-time insights into application and data performance.
  • Model Deployment and Monitoring: Deploy machine learning models and implement monitoring solutions to track model performance, drift, and health. 
  • Data Quality and Governance: Implement data quality checks and data governance practices to ensure data accuracy, consistency, and compliance with data privacy regulations.
  •  MLOps (Added Advantage): Contribute to the implementation of MLOps practices, including model deployment, monitoring, and automation of machine learning workflows.
  • Documentation: Maintain clear and comprehensive documentation for data engineering processes, ELK configurations, machine learning models, visualizations, and deployments.

The skills you bring:

  • Core Skills: Strong Python programming skills, experience building data pipelines, and knowledge of ELK stack (ElasticSearch, Logstash, Kibana).
  • Distributed Processing: Familiarity with Spark fundamentals and when to leverage distributed processing for large datasets.
  • Cloud & Containerization: Practical experience deploying applications and services on Kubernetes. Familiarity with Docker and container best practices.
  • Monitoring & Visualization: Hands-on experience creating dashboards and alerts with Grafana and Kibana.
  • ML & MLOps: Experience collaborating on ML model development, and deploying and monitoring ML models in production; knowledge of model monitoring, drift detection and CI/CD for ML is a plus.
  • Experience criteria is 9 to 14years
